US Economy, Trucking Industry Poised for Strong Recovery, Economists Predict

Both the US economy and the Trucking industry are expected to see big recoveries in the second half of 2021, as millions of Americans receive COVID-19 vaccines and return to normal levels of spending. Chief Economist of the American Trucking Associations said that he believes all sectors — including those that experienced a downturn during the pandemic, will see a jump in business.
